The P&O Registered Technician role is integral to the fabrication of custom prostheses and/or orthoses.  Technicians work closely with clinical staff in the design and are responsible for the physical creation of the device, which may involve working with various metals, plastics, foams, and the use of CAD software.  Our technicians may assist in evaluation appointments and are involved in after care follow up/maintenance of the device.
